Parts list
Main components, grouped by system.
Bike components
Frame
Frame
Tig Welded Double Butted Chromoly Tubing, IS Disc Mount
Suspension Fork
Curved Blade Uni-Crown Disc Chromoly
Drivetrain
Rear Derailleur
Shimano Tiagra R4700
Front Derailleur
Shimano 105 R5801
Shift Levers
Shimano Tiagra R4700
Cassette
Shimano HG-500, 11/32T 10-spd
Crank
Shimano Tiagra R4700 50/34T
Bottom Bracket
Shimano Sealed Cartridge
Chain
KMC X10
Pedals
N/A
Wheels
Front Hub
Alloy Disc Sealed Bearing, QR, 32h
Rear Hub
Alloy Disc Sealed Bearing, QR, 32h
Rims
Brev M. 23mm internal Tubeless Compatible, Double Wall
Tires
WTB Horizon Tubeless 650x47mm, Dual DNA Compound, Lightweight Tubeless Casing, UST
Brakes
Brakes
Promax DSK300R Mechanical Disc, 160mm Rotor F/R
Brake Levers
Shimano Tiagra R4700
Cockpit
Stem
Brev. M 3D Forged Alloy, 31.8mm
Handlebar
Brev. M Compact Adventure Bend Alloy, 12 Degree Flair, 31.8mm
Headset
1 1/8" FSA Orbit X Sealed
Seat
Saddle
Masi Corsa Comp
Seatpost
Brev. M Alloy, 27.2mm
Fit data
Numbers for sizing and ride feel.
| Size | 49cm | 51cm | 53cm | 56cm | 58cm | 60cm |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Stack Reach Ratio | 1.52 mm | 1.51 mm | 1.53 mm | 1.53 mm | 1.52 mm | 1.52 mm |
| Front Center | 566 mm | 583 mm | 584 mm | 610 mm | 630 mm | 645 mm |
| Rake | 65 mm | 65 mm | 65 mm | 65 mm | 65 mm | 65 mm |
| Trail | 50 mm | 49 mm | 51 mm | 51 mm | 51 mm | 51 mm |
| Stack | 543 mm | 559 mm | 580 mm | 608 mm | 625 mm | 643 mm |
| Reach | 358 mm | 369 mm | 380 mm | 398 mm | 412 mm | 422 mm |
| Top Tube Length | 509 mm | 530 mm | 551 mm | 582 mm | 602 mm | 622 mm |
| Seat Tube Angle | 74.5 ° | 74 ° | 73.5 ° | 73 ° | 73 ° | 72.5 ° |
| Seat Tube Length | 490 mm | 510 mm | 530 mm | 560 mm | 580 mm | 600 mm |
| Head Tube Angle | 72 ° | 72 ° | 73 ° | 73 ° | 73 ° | 73 ° |
| Head Tube Length | 101 mm | 118 mm | 133 mm | 163 mm | 181 mm | 199 mm |
| Chainstay Length | 435 mm | 435 mm | 435 mm | 435 mm | 435 mm | 435 mm |
| Wheelbase | 991 mm | 1008 mm | 1009 mm | 1035 mm | 1055 mm | 1070 mm |
| Bottom Bracket Drop | 70 mm | 70 mm | 70 mm | 70 mm | 70 mm | 70 mm |
| Standover Height | 766 mm | 783 mm | 803 mm | 831 mm | 849 mm | 868 mm |
| Wheels | 650 | 650 | 650 | 650 | 650 | 650 |
